Hamptons Pride, Inc. is an all-volunteer not-for-profit public charity (tax exempt under Section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code - EIN 86-3600121) that celebrates and commemorates the LGBTQ+ populations and their allies on the East End of Long Island. Established by locals for the benefit of locals, the organization's founding goal is the creation of an historical marker and outdoor social area on the footprint of The Swamp (the last and longest-running gay club in the Hamptons) in what is now Wainscott Green, a park in the Town of East Hampton.
